    Actually base pay from $95k to $120 k at the end of yr 5 . $50 k of the $170 k is benefits like health ins and 401k. As is always said benefits are 30-40% of all pay . $120 k is great for a driver but not the eye popping headline # of $170 k. This is exactly why self employed people cheap so much on their taxes. If they didn’t calculating having no benefits they’d actually be losing money
